Coinbase Expands Offerings with Stock and ETF Trading

In a significant expansion of its trading capabilities, Coinbase has announced that it will be adding stock and ETF trading to its platform. This strategic shift for the cryptocurrency exchange allows it to broaden its portfolio and potentially attract a new demographic of traders and investors. By venturing beyond its traditional crypto offerings, Coinbase aims to position itself as an ‘everything exchange,’ capable of catering to a wider range of financial needs.

Coinbase's foray into the trading of stocks and exchange-traded funds (ETFs) sets the stage for robust competition in the financial trading space, particularly against established players like Robinhood. Known for its user-friendly interface and commission-free trading model, Robinhood has already captured a significant share of the market. Now, with Coinbase stepping into the arena, the rivalry between the two platforms is expected to heat up, especially as they compete for the attention of both novice traders and seasoned investors.
